What is Liempo cut?
LIEMPO. A definite crowd-pleaser, the liempo or pork belly is the fattiest cut with alternating layers of meat and fat, making it the most flavorful of the pork cuts. It can be used interchangeably in dishes with the kasim if you want a more flavorful and fatty pork dish.
What is Liempo in english?
liempo (plural liempos) (Philippines) pork belly; streaky pork.
What is Filipino Inihaw?
Inihaw (pronounced [ɪˈni:haʊ] ee-NEE-how), also known as sinugba or inasal, are various types of grilled or pit-roasted barbecue dishes from the Philippines. They are usually made from pork or chicken and are served on bamboo skewers or in small cubes with a soy sauce and vinegar-based dip.
What is kasim In pork?
Kasim is a cut from the thicker section of the pig’s shoulder. This meat cut is extremely succulent when cooked because it has a layer of fat that runs through the meat. The fat keeps the meat moist and tender as it cooks, and it’ll give your dish an added depth of flavor!

Should I boil pork before frying?
Boil, Season, and Deep Fry
There are times when pork needs to be boiled before frying. Boiling makes it tender and gives is a more crisp texture when fried later on. This is true to dishes such as lechon kawali and crispy pata.
